Internet Law Bulletin

As the internet continues its exponential growth and companies invest more time and money in e-commerce, their legal advisers are faced with the challenges of adapting existing laws to the medium and maintaining currency with legal reform.The Internet Law Bulletin was created to address the range of legal issues posed by the internet and online services: issues as diverse as copyright, defamation, online dispute resolution, privacy, trade practices and criminal law.The newsletter includes analysis of case law, discussion of new and proposed legislation, reports on significant inquiries and research, and news updates on legal developments both in Australia and overseas.
